abacab Posted April 13, 2023 Posted April 13, 2023 The assigned I/O ports for the instrument track are possibly different than when you first created the existing project. Cakewalk can shuffle them around, especially if you connect new audio hardware to the PC, or switch to a new PC. Probably not obvious, but worth checking the routing carefully and compare with a new project. 1
Ross S Posted April 18, 2023 Posted April 18, 2023 Do you have multiple takes on your midi track? Have you checked your take lanes? If you’re in comp mode, it could be causing that. If it’s sending properly when you’re in piano roll, it most likely has something to do with your clips.

John Vere Posted April 20, 2023 Posted April 20, 2023 Clip mute as mentioned above. Not track mute. Had this happen. I think there’s a keyboard shortcut that you accidentally can toggle it with. Open clip properties in the track inspector and look for the mute
